Core Skills Analysis

Cooking

  • Through cooking, the 15-year-old student has learned practical application of math concepts such as measurements and fractions.
  • The student has also enhanced their understanding of science principles like chemical reactions and the effects of heat on ingredients.
  • Cooking has helped the student improve their organizational skills by following recipes and managing multiple tasks simultaneously.
  • The activity has also fostered creativity in the student by experimenting with flavors and presentation.

Tips

To further develop cooking skills, the student can try exploring different cuisines from around the world to broaden their culinary knowledge. They can also experiment with creating their own recipes by modifying existing ones and documenting the results for future reference. Additionally, participating in cooking challenges or competitions can provide a fun way to test and improve their skills while gaining valuable feedback from others. Lastly, practicing effective time management and prioritization in the kitchen can help the student become more efficient and confident in their cooking abilities.
